首页 > 生活经验 >

excel中怎么对数据进行排名次

2025-09-25 13:38:15

问题描述:

excel中怎么对数据进行排名次,真的急需答案,求回复!

最佳答案

推荐答案

2025-09-25 13:38:15

excel中怎么对数据进行排名次】在日常工作中,Excel 是我们处理数据的重要工具,而对数据进行排名是数据分析中常见的操作。无论是成绩排名、销售业绩排名还是其他数值的排序,掌握 Excel 的排名方法可以大大提高工作效率。

以下是一些常用的 Excel 数据排名方法,并以表格形式总结了每种方法的使用场景和步骤。

一、使用 RANK 函数进行排名

RANK 函数是 Excel 中最基础的排名函数,适用于单个数据点的排名计算。

语法:

`=RANK(数值, 数据范围, [排序方式])`

- 数值:要排名的单元格;

- 数据范围:包含所有需要比较的数据区域;

- 排序方式:可选参数,1 表示降序(默认),0 或省略表示升序。

示例:

假设 A 列为成绩,B 列为排名,B2 单元格输入公式:

`=RANK(A2, $A$2:$A$10)`

学生 成绩 排名
张三 85 3
李四 92 1
王五 88 2
赵六 76 4

二、使用 RANK.EQ 函数(推荐)

RANK.EQ 是 RANK 函数的更新版本,功能相同,但更符合 Excel 的最新标准,推荐使用。

语法:

`=RANK.EQ(数值, 数据范围, [排序方式])`

与 RANK 相同,使用方式一致。

三、使用 RANK.AVG 函数(处理并列排名)

如果存在多个相同数值,RANK.AVG 会返回它们的平均排名,适合需要处理并列情况的场景。

语法:

`=RANK.AVG(数值, 数据范围, [排序方式])`

示例:

若两个学生都得 90 分,RANK.AVG 会将他们的排名设为 1.5。

四、使用排序功能手动排名

对于少量数据或简单需求,可以直接通过“排序”功能实现排名。

步骤:

1. 选中数据区域;

2. 点击“数据”选项卡 → “排序”;

3. 设置排序字段和顺序(升序/降序);

4. 排序后,手动添加排名列。

五、使用公式结合 ROW 函数实现动态排名

对于动态数据表,可以使用公式配合 ROW 函数实现自动排名。

示例:

在 C2 输入公式:

`=COUNTIF($A$2:$A$10, ">"&A2)+1`

此公式会根据当前单元格的值,统计比它大的数量,加上 1 得到排名。

总结表格

方法 函数名称 是否支持并列 适用场景 优点
RANK 函数 RANK 基础排名 简单易用
RANK.EQ RANK.EQ 推荐使用 更符合新版 Excel 标准
RANK.AVG RANK.AVG 并列排名 自动处理重复值
手动排序 排序功能 小数据量 操作直观
公式 + ROW COUNTIF + ROW 动态数据表 可自动更新

通过以上方法,你可以灵活地在 Excel 中对数据进行排名。根据实际需求选择合适的方式,能有效提升工作效率。

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。